Transaction 3528c243071f0f511739a2faf99531d64c4c730512e86e146e114f456e19c8ac
1 Input
2 Outputs
- 3528c243071f0f511739a2faf99531d64c4c730512e86e146e114f456e19c8ac:0
- 3528c243071f0f511739a2faf99531d64c4c730512e86e146e114f456e19c8ac:1
value 168516
address 1FdeZPLCsYEoc1Vq2i3WyEJjzW9eoY4rv2
value 860387
address 34EQpYtAPGz99mShKyiBCYiGop7nRSQm1V